The Marine Corps differs in this regard since all Marine aircraft within a given squadron have the same tail code regardless of where the unit is stationed or moves over time. Two LSDs (landing ships, dock), two AKAs When the war began in 1965, the Marine Corps was authorized 54 deployable aircraft squadrons in the Fleet Marine Forces: 30 jet, 3 propeller transport, 18 helicopter transport, and 3 observation. Aviation units within the Marine Corps are assigned to support the Marine Air-Ground Task Force, as the aviation combat element, by providing six functions: assault support, antiair warfare, close air support, electronic warfare, control of aircraft and missiles, and aerial reconnaissance.
